Searchin' the Desert for the Blues by Swing Republic, Blind Willie McTell is a bass-heavy Dance track at 97 BPM with moderate drive and strong groove. At 53% energy, it works as a mid-set sustainer — enough momentum to keep the floor moving.

97 BPM — squarely in dance territory, mixable within roughly 92–102 BPM without pitch artefacts.
C Major — 8B on the Camelot wheel. Harmonically compatible with 8A, 7B and 9B.
